I have a nice long and smooth driveway. I've always wanted to put a curb along one side of it for slappys and dorking around. Now that my son is getting more comfortable on his skateboard it would be pretty cool to have a little spot where he can learn some tricks. I've also been toying around with the idea of starting a weekly scheduled "Old Man Curb Club" session and beer drinking hang out. I've watched a few videos on youtube with people making forms and molds but the end results weren't really impressive. They'd be great for a diy skatespot but not something I'd want in my driveway. I came across this video/ad the other day and I really like how the curb turns out. I like that you can also do curves if you wanted to. I think if I used the steeper side it would make a fun skate curb. Any thoughts, suggestions or ideas? If you've made your own curb post up a pic.
